Надёжность, удобство, скорость — ваш Ethereum здесь
Главная > Разное > Как создать DAO на Ethereum

Как создать DAO на Ethereum

Как создать DAO на Ethereum

DAO (децентрализованная автономная организация) — это новая форма управления проектами и сообществами, где решения принимаются автоматически или через голосование, без центральной власти. Основанные на блокчейне, такие структуры уже используются для запуска криптопроектов, распределения токенов, управления фондами и поддержки стартапов. Ethereum остаётся основной платформой для создания DAO благодаря своей открытой архитектуре, наличию смарт-контрактов и широкому инструментарию.

В этой статье мы подробно разберём, как создать DAO на Ethereum с нуля, какие платформы использовать, какие функции обязательно реализовать и какие ошибки следует избежать. Мы также рассмотрим юридические и технические аспекты, которые нужно учитывать при запуске децентрализованной организации в 2025 году.

Что такое DAO и зачем оно нужно

DAO (Decentralized Autonomous Organization) — это организация, управляемая через правила, запрограммированные в смарт-контрактах. Такие структуры не зависят от традиционного руководства и обеспечивают прозрачное, доверительное и автоматизированное управление.

Основные преимущества DAO

  • Прозрачность: все действия фиксируются в блокчейне.
  • Безопасность: код смарт-контрактов заменяет человеческий фактор.
  • Автономия: управление осуществляется без централизованного вмешательства.
  • Глобальность: участники могут находиться в любой точке мира.

Подготовка к созданию DAO на Ethereum

Выбор цели DAO

Перед созданием нужно чётко определить, что будет делать DAO:

  • Управление инвестиционным фондом;
  • Поддержка NFT-проекта;
  • Голосование по вопросам сообщества;
  • Финансирование разработок и грантов;
  • Управление DAO-токенами и их распределением.

Юридические аспекты

Хотя DAO по своей природе децентрализованы, многие юрисдикции уже начали их регулировать. Перед запуском DAO стоит рассмотреть:

  • Возможность регистрации как юридического лица (например, DAO LLC в Вайоминге, США);
  • Налоговые последствия;
  • Правила KYC/AML при взаимодействии с участниками.

Выбор блокчейна: почему Ethereum

Ethereum остаётся лидером в создании DAO по следующим причинам:

  • Поддержка смарт-контрактов на Solidity;
  • Большое сообщество разработчиков;
  • Интеграция с DeFi и NFT-протоколами;
  • Инфраструктура для голосования, кошельков и токенов (ERC-20, ERC-721).

Платформы и инструменты для создания DAO

Популярные фреймворки

  1. Aragon — модульная платформа для создания DAO с интерфейсом управления, токенами и голосованием.
  2. DAOstack — поддерживает схемы голосования и Holographic Consensus.
  3. Gnosis Safe + Zodiac — DAO на основе multisig-кошельков и модулей.
  4. Moloch DAO — минималистичная модель DAO с фокусом на простоту.
  5. Tally + OpenZeppelin Governor — управление DAO через голосование и расширяемые контракты.

Инструменты для разработки

  • Solidity — язык программирования смарт-контрактов.
  • Hardhat / Foundry — среда разработки и тестирования.
  • IPFS / Arweave — хранение данных вне блокчейна.
  • Snapshot — система голосования без газа (off-chain).

Пошаговая инструкция: как создать DAO на Ethereum

Шаг 1. Определите правила DAO

Нужно описать:

  • Роль токена (управление, голосование, стейкинг);
  • Механизмы голосования (простое большинство, кворум);
  • Порог принятия решений;
  • Варианты выхода из DAO.

Шаг 2. Создайте смарт-контракты DAO

Если вы используете платформу (например, Aragon), большая часть работы будет сделана за вас. Если пишете с нуля:

  • Напишите контракт токена (ERC-20);
  • Добавьте логику голосования;
  • Определите роли: создатель, администратор, участник.

Шаг 3. Разверните контракт в сети Ethereum

  • Выберите сеть: mainnet или testnet (Sepolia, Goerli);
  • Разверните контракт через Remix или Hardhat;
  • Проверьте адреса, ABI и взаимодействие с интерфейсом.

Шаг 4. Настройте интерфейс

Если используется Aragon — создаётся интерфейс автоматически. Для самостоятельной сборки можно использовать React + Web3.js или Ethers.js.

Шаг 5. Привлеките участников и начните голосование

  • Проведите Airdrop или продажу токенов;
  • Создайте первый пропозал (предложение);
  • Настройте Snapshot для голосований без комиссии.

Примеры успешных DAO

MakerDAO

Управляет стейблкоином DAI. Одно из первых DAO, внедрившее комплексное управление активами.

Uniswap DAO

Управление развитием децентрализированной биржи через UNI-токены. Все решения о функциях и грантах принимаются голосованием.

Gitcoin DAO

Финансирует проекты с открытым кодом на основе голоса сообщества.

Friends With Benefits (FWB)

DAO-комьюнити для создателей, художников и веб3-энтузиастов.

Сравнение DAO-платформ

ПлатформаИнтерфейсЯзык контрактовГолосованиеПримечание
AragonДаSolidityOn-chainПростой запуск, высокая поддержка
DAOstackЧастичноSolidityHolographicБолее сложное управление
Gnosis Safe + ZodiacДаSolidityМультиподписиГибкость, безопасность
MolochНетSolidityOn-chainМинимализм, высокая эффективность
Tally + OpenZeppelinНетSolidityOn-chain + SnapshotНастраиваемая логика голосования

Заключение

Создание DAO на Ethereum в 2025 году стало доступным даже для неразработчиков благодаря открытым фреймворкам и мощным инструментам управления. При этом важно помнить, что DAO — не просто технология, а социальная структура, которая требует продуманной архитектуры, юридической устойчивости и прозрачности.

Правильно организованная децентрализованная организация может стать надёжной платформой для инвестиций, коллективных решений и построения сильного сообщества в Web3-мире. Учитывайте цели, выберите подходящую платформу и начните с простого MVP — эволюция DAO строится итеративно.